Blacklist Tournaments

Post by Bojan »

Electronic Arts announced that it will host the first of six Need for Speed Most Wanted Blacklist Regional Tournaments in Houston, TX at the Formula Drift Championship on June 11, 2005. In addition to being the first people in the country to play the game, attendees will have a chance to compete for numerous prizes including a Finals Grand Prize Trip Package to attend the Need for Speed Most Wanted launch event in November 2005. Highlights from the Tournament will be televised on G4 – videogame tv’s drifting series, “Formula D” on Sunday, July 10, at 10:30 PM ET/7:30 PM PT.
